I agree with what you say, generally addimpulse should probably be used once (not every frame) for (as you mentioned) explosions, hits and things like that but I’m wondering what the actual difference with addforce would be assuming you apply per-tick for something like gravity simulation, buoyancy, an aircraft thruster and things along those lines… constant forces.